Dark chocolate



A 2009 study in ACS' Journal of Proteome Research found that consuming about one and a half ounces of dark chocolate a day for two weeks reduced levels of stress hormones in highly stressed subjects. Keep in mind that chocolate is high in calories and fat, so be mindful of portion size (one and a half ounces has about 230 calories and 13 grams of fat).
